Summary
Amend Section 12-36-2120, Code Of Laws Of South Carolina, 1976, Relating To Exemptions From The State Sales Tax, So As To Exempt Prepared Meals, Prepared Food, And Beverages; And By Adding Section 6-1-780 So As To Exempt Prepared Meals, Prepared Food, And Beverages From The Local Hospitality Tax.
Title
Sales and hospitality tax exemptions
